Please, I need help in this ??

Answers

Answer:

[tex]\int\frac{x^{4}}{x^{4} -1}dx = x + \frac{1}{4} ln(x-1) - \frac{1}{4} ln(x+1)-\frac{1}{2} arctanx + c[/tex]

Step-by-step explanation:

[tex]\int\frac{x^{4}}{x^{4} -1}dx[/tex]

Adding and Subtracting 1 to the Numerator

[tex]\int\frac{x^{4} - 1 + 1}{x^{4} -1}dx[/tex]

Dividing Numerator seperately by [tex]x^{4} - 1[/tex]

[tex]\int 1 + \frac{1}{x^{4}-1 }\, dx[/tex]

Here integral of 1 is x +c1 (where c1 is constant of integration

[tex]x + c1 + \int\frac{1}{(x-1)(x+1)(x^{2}+1)}\, dx[/tex]----------------------------------(1)

We apply method of partial fractions to perform the integral

[tex]\frac{1}{(x-1)(x+1)(x^{2}+1)}[/tex] = [tex]\frac{A}{x-1} + \frac{B}{x+1} + \frac{C}{x^{2} + 1}[/tex]------------------------------------------(2)

[tex]\frac{1}{(x-1)(x+1)(x^{2}+1)} = \frac{A(x+1)(x^{2} +1) + B(x-1)(x^{2} +1) + C(x-1)(x+1)}{(x-1)(x+1)(x^{2} +1)}[/tex]

1 = [tex]A(x+1)(x^{2} +1) + B(x-1)(x^{2} +1) + C(x-1)(x+1)[/tex]-------------------------(3)

Substitute x= 1 , -1 , i in equation (3)

1 = A(1+1)(1+1)

A = [tex]\frac{1}{4}[/tex]

1 = B(-1-1)(1+1)

B = [tex]-\frac{1}{4}[/tex]

1 = C(i-1)(i+1)

C = [tex]-\frac{1}{2}[/tex]

Substituting A, B, C in equation (2)

[tex]\int\frac{x^{4}}{x^{4} -1}dx[/tex] = [tex]\int\frac{1}{4(x-1)} - \frac{1}{4(x+1)} -\frac{1}{2(x^{2}+1) }[/tex]

On integration

Here [tex]\int \frac{1}{x}dx = lnx and \int\frac{1}{x^{2}+1 } dx = arctanx[/tex]

[tex]\int\frac{x^{4}}{x^{4} -1}dx[/tex] = [tex]\frac{1}{4} ln(x-1)[/tex] - [tex]\frac{1}{4} ln(x+1)[/tex] - [tex]\frac{1}{2} arctanx[/tex] + c2---------------------------------------(4)

Substitute equation (4) back in equation (1) we get

[tex]x + c1 + \frac{1}{4} ln(x-1) - \frac{1}{4} ln(x+1) - \frac{1}{2} arctanx + c2[/tex]

Here c1 + c2 can be added to another and written as c

Therefore,

[tex]\int\frac{x^{4}}{x^{4} -1}dx = x + \frac{1}{4} ln(x-1) - \frac{1}{4} ln(x+1)-\frac{1}{2} arctanx + c[/tex]

The measure of an angle is three times the measure of its supplementary angle. What is the measure of each angle?

Answers

Answer:

Angle = 135°

Supplement of the Angle = 45°

Step-by-step explanation:

The complement of an angle, say "x", would be 90 minus that angle:

90 - x

The supplement of an angle, say "y", would be 180 minus that angle:

180 - y

Since we have 1 angle, let it be "x", and that angle is 3 TIMES the SUPPLEMENT of that angle, we can write:

x = 3(180 - x)

Now, we solve for the angle x:

[tex]x = 3(180 - x)\\x = 540 - 3x\\x + 3x = 540\\4x = 540\\x = \frac{540}{4}\\x=135[/tex]

So, the angle is 135°

The supplement of the angle is  180 - 135 = 45°

Final answer:

The measure of the smaller angle is 45 degrees, and the larger angle, which is three times the size of the smaller one, measures 135 degrees.

Explanation:

The subject of this question falls under the branch of Mathematics, specifically geometry. The question deals with supplementary angles, which are pairs of angles that add up to 180 degrees.

Let's denote the smaller angle as 'x.' According to the problem, the larger angle is three times the size of the smaller, thus it is 3x. Because these are supplementary angles, they add up to form 180 degrees. So, we can create this equation: x + 3x = 180.

By simplifying and solving for x, we get: 4x = 180, hence x = 45 degrees. Therefore, the larger angle, which is three times the smaller, is 3*45 = 135 degrees.

Result

In conclusion, the measure of the smaller angle is 45 degrees while the larger angle measures 135 degrees.
